Summary
White Mountain National Forest Wilderness Act of 1983 - Designates the following lands in the White Mountain National Forest in New Hampshire as components of the National Wilderness Preservation System: (1) the Pemigewasset Wilderness Area; (2) the Sandwich Range Wilderness; and (3) the Presidential Range Dry River Wilderness Additions. Provides that the RARE II (second roadless area review and evaluation) final environmental statement (dated January 1979) with respect to national forest system lands in New Hampshire and Maine shall not be subject to judicial review. Releases national forest system lands in New Hampshire and Maine which were reviewed in the RARE II program from further review by the Department of Agriculture, pending revision of initial national forest management plans. Releases lands in New Hampshire and Maine reviewed in the RARE II program and not designated as wilderness from management as wilderness areas. Prohibits the Department of Agriculture from conducting any further statewide roadless area review and evaluation of national forest system lands in New Hampshire and Maine without express congressional authorization.
